"Matka" (Mother) is a poignant drawing by Slovak artist Arnold Peter Weisz-Kubínčan, known for his expressive and often melancholic depictions of human figures. The work, executed in blue chalk, portrays a woman's head and torso, her face obscured by a headscarf, creating a sense of introspection and quiet contemplation. The loose, gestural lines and the somber tone of the drawing reflect a sense of realism characteristic of Kubínčan's style. This intimate portrayal of a woman, likely a mother, evokes a feeling of warmth, quietude, and the powerful bond between parent and child.
